Understanding UPVC Panels

Before going over repair approaches, it's important to understand what UPVC panels are and why they are extensively used:

  • Durability: UPVC panels are resistant to rot, deterioration, and harsh weather, making them ideal for a variety of environments.
  • Insulation: They offer outstanding thermal insulation, which can contribute to energy savings.
  • Visual Variety: UPVC panels can be found in various styles, colors, and finishes that can complement any style theme.

Step-by-Step Guide to UPVC Panel Repair

1. Tools and Materials Needed

Before starting the repair, collect the following tools and materials:

  • UPVC adhesive or solvent
  • Sandpaper (fine and medium grit)
  • UPVC filler (for cracks and dents)
  • Paint or polish for touch-ups
  • Tidy cloth
  • Gloves
  • Utility knife
  • Masking tape

2. Assess the Damage

Inspect the panel to identify the degree of the damage. This examination will assist your repair approach. For small scratches, a basic polish may be adequate, while much deeper cracks might require a more detailed repair.

3. Preparing the Area

  • Clean the Surface: Use a clean cloth to eliminate any dirt and particles from the affected location. A clean surface will ensure better adhesion for fillers and adhesives.
  • Masking Tape: Apply masking tape around the damage to secure the surrounding locations from scratches or accidental application of repair products.

4. Repairing Scratches and Minor Dents

For Scratches:

  1. Sand the scratched area gently with fine-grit sandpaper.
  2. Clean the location once again to get rid of dust.
  3. Apply UPVC polish to bring back shine.

For Dents:

  1. Use an energy knife to gently scrape away any loose product around the damage.
  2. Fill the dent using UPVC filler, smoothing it out with a putty knife.
  3. When dried, sand the area with fine-grit sandpaper for an even surface.
  4. Polish the location as required.

5. Fixing Cracks

  1. Broaden the fracture slightly with an utility knife so that it can be filled successfully.
  2. Clean the crack thoroughly.
  3. Apply UPVC adhesive or filler, ensuring it permeates deep into the crack.
  4. Use a putty knife to smooth the surface area.
  5. As soon as dry, sand the area to blend it with the remainder of the panel.

6. Touching Up Color

If the repair process has affected the panel's color:

  • Use UPVC paint or a polish that matches the existing color.
  • Apply it evenly with a brush or cloth.
  • Allow it to dry completely before getting rid of masking tape.

7. Last Inspection

After repair work are complete, check the area carefully. Ensure it appears intact and visually enticing. This action is vital for maintaining the general visual of your home.

Often Asked Questions (FAQs)

1. For how long do UPVC panels last?

UPVC panels can last 20-30 years with proper care and maintenance. Regular examination for signs of wear can assist extend their life-span.

2. Can I repair a split UPVC panel myself?

Yes, minor repairs such as scratches, damages, and little fractures can frequently be done by homeowners with basic tools and materials. Nevertheless, for significant damage, it's suggested to consult an expert.

3. What is the best method to tidy UPVC panels?

Using a mild cleaning agent blended with water is advised. Prevent abrasive cleaners that can scratch the surface.

4. Will sunshine trigger damage to UPVC panels?

Yes, extended direct exposure to sunlight can cause staining and surface area degradation. Utilizing UV-resistant paint can assist alleviate this result.

5. Can UPVC panels be painted?

Yes, UPVC panels can be painted. It's vital to use specially developed UPVC paint for the best adhesion and finish.
